 What Are the Key Characteristics of a Healthy Relationship?

A healthy relationship is based on mutual respect, trust, communication, and support. It involves an ongoing effort from both parties to meet each other’s needs while maintaining their own individual identities. While every relationship is unique, the key components of a healthy relationship are universal.

The Role of Mutual Respect and Understanding in Healthy Relationships

Respect is one of the cornerstones of a healthy relationship. When both individuals show respect for each other’s thoughts, feelings, and needs, it creates a balanced dynamic where both partners feel valued and heard. Respect is not just about agreeing with one another; it is about accepting each other’s differences and working together to find common ground.

Healthy relationships thrive when both parties practice empathy. Building Trust and Transparency in a Healthy Relationship

Trust is another essential element in any healthy relationship. It is the belief that both parties are reliable, honest, and dependable. Without trust, relationships can feel uncertain and insecure, leading to misunderstandings and resentment.

Building trust requires time, honesty, and consistent actions. Why Communication and Active Listening Matter in Healthy Relationships

Effective communication is vital for the longevity of any healthy relationship. This does not just mean talking openly, but also actively listening to one another. Good communication allows partners to express their feelings, share their concerns, and resolve conflicts in a constructive manner.

When communication is open and honest, misunderstandings are less likely to occur. Setting Healthy Boundaries in Relationships for Mutual Respect

Setting and respecting boundaries is a crucial aspect of any healthy relationship. Boundaries help individuals maintain their personal space, protect their emotional health, and avoid unnecessary conflict. Without clear boundaries, relationships can become imbalanced, leading to resentment or feelings of being overwhelmed.

In a healthy relationship, both partners are comfortable with setting limits and expressing their needs. Recognizing Toxic Behaviors and Maintaining Healthy Boundaries

While healthy relationships are built on trust, respect, and open communication, it is equally important to recognize and address toxic behaviors. Toxic behaviors can manifest as manipulation, control, dishonesty, or disrespect. If left unchecked, they can damage the foundation of a relationship and harm both individuals involved.

Being able to identify toxic patterns is crucial in maintaining a healthy relationship. How to Foster Healthy Relationships

Creating and nurturing healthy relationships requires consistent effort and attention. Here are some practical tips to help you foster stronger, more meaningful connections:

  1. Prioritize Communication: Make time for honest, open conversations. Share your feelings, concerns, and aspirations, and listen actively when your partner or friend speaks.
  2. Show Appreciation: Express gratitude for the people in your life. Small gestures of kindness, whether it is a thoughtful note or a simple compliment, can go a long way.
  3. Invest Time and Energy: Relationships require ongoing effort. Spend quality time together, engage in activities that foster connection, and make an effort to understand one another’s needs.
  4. Practice Forgiveness: No one is perfect, and mistakes will happen. Learn to forgive and move forward, understanding that forgiveness is an essential part of healing and growth in relationships.
